From d6b2fbeb9dc7a00f46c8951f725d1bce60465f8b Mon Sep 17 00:00:00 2001 From: Guy Sartorelli <36352093+GuySartorelli@users.noreply.github.com> Date: Fri, 13 Sep 2024 17:18:51 +1200 Subject: [PATCH] API Deprecate API that will be removed (#240) --- src/Tasks/UpdatePackageInfoTask.php |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/src/Tasks/UpdatePackageInfoTask.php b/src/Tasks/UpdatePackageInfoTask.php index a98a6cc..e11e400 100644 --- a/src/Tasks/UpdatePackageInfoTask.php +++ b/src/Tasks/UpdatePackageInfoTask.php @@ -65,6 +65,7 @@ class UpdatePackageInfoTask extends BuildTask /** * @var SupportedAddonsLoader + * @deprecated 3.3.0 Will be removed without equivalent functionality */ protected $supportedAddonsLoader; @@ -99,18 +100,24 @@ public function setComposerLoader($composerLoader) /** * @return SupportedAddonsLoader + * @deprecated 3.3.0 Will be removed without equivalent functionality */ public function getSupportedAddonsLoader() { + Deprecation::notice('3.3.0', 'Will be removed without equivalent functionality'); return $this->supportedAddonsLoader; } /** * @param SupportedAddonsLoader $supportedAddonsLoader * @return $this + * @deprecated 3.3.0 Will be removed without equivalent functionality */ public function setSupportedAddonsLoader(SupportedAddonsLoader $supportedAddonsLoader) { + Deprecation::withNoReplacement( + fn() => Deprecation::notice('3.3.0', 'Will be removed without equivalent functionality') + ); $this->supportedAddonsLoader = $supportedAddonsLoader; return $this; }